How to Define Activities

Activities are in the details. You must evaluate every step involved to produce a project deliverable. Work through the following three steps to create a thorough and detailed activity list.

Review Deliverables Individually
expand arrow
  • Work through each project deliverable one at a time.
Identify Steps from Start to Finish
expand arrow
  • Identify the first thing that needs to happen to produce the deliverable;
  • Determine the next step, and the step after that;
  • Continue until all steps are outlined from start to finish.
Probe Further and Look for Gaps
expand arrow
  • Review all steps for completeness;
  • Identify any missing steps;
  • Determine if any steps can be broken down further.
